How to read this

The three layers where the field actually differs

Every serious tool in this category can tell you whether ChatGPT, Perplexity or Google's AI surfaces mention your brand. The differences that matter live in three less-visible layers: whether anyone reads the crawler traffic that decides what engines know, whether anyone ships the fixes the monitoring implies, and whether the results you're shown would survive an audit. Those are the three layers AirPulse was built around.

01

Done-with-you remediation, verified by live audits

Most platforms stop at recommendations or hand you software agents to operate. AirPulse ships the fixes with your team, rendering, schema, sitemaps, llms.txt, content, and re-audits the live site before any score is reported. Across the field, only agency retainers (e.g., Daydream) and customer-operated software agents (Profound, Goodie) come close.

02

Agent Pulse: real crawler and agent log analytics

What AI bots actually fetch is the ground truth of AI visibility, and most tools never look at it. As of June 2026, crawler/agent log analytics exists at Profound, Scrunch, Hall and Adobe, and is absent from Peec, Bluefish (no public evidence), Evertune, AthenaHQ, the Semrush Toolkit, Ahrefs and Surfer. Agent Pulse reads that traffic and feeds it straight into the remediation queue.

03

A published evidence standard

Control groups, consistent measurement windows, per-day normalization, live re-verified audits, disclosed confounds. Nobody else in this market leads with methodology. We do, because we'd rather show one number that survives the hard question than ten that don't, and because attribution to traffic and revenue is still a near-universal gap (AthenaHQ and Goodie are the honorable exceptions).

The wider field

Every tool we get asked about

Pricing as of June 2026; figures marked “reported” come from third-party sources, not vendor price pages.

ToolBest forPricingIn one line vs AirPulse
ProfoundFortune 500 + agencies wanting one enterprise suiteSales-led; reported ~$499–$5,000+/moThe category leader by scale; software your team operates, with no done-with-you delivery
Scrunch AIMid-market teams wanting agent-delivery middlewarePublic, from $250/mo annual; 7-day trialServes an optimized layer to agents; AirPulse fixes the source site
Peec AIMarketing teams + agencies needing clean daily trackingSelf-serve, from ~€89/moExcellent tracker, deliberately monitoring-only, with no remediation and no crawler analytics
Bluefish AIFortune 500 orgs needing brand-fact governanceUndisclosed; demo-gatedBrand control and hallucination correction at enterprise scale; no GA4 attribution
Semrush AI ToolkitExisting Semrush customers adding an AI lens$99/mo per domain; AIO undisclosedCheapest credible entry; per-domain costs compound, no crawler analytics, Adobe-bound
EvertuneEnterprise brand measurement at statistical scaleUndisclosed; reported ~$3,000/mo annualBiggest prompt samples in the category; measurement-first, execution stays with you
AthenaHQSelf-serve teams wanting attribution + broad engines$295/mo self-serve; Enterprise customRare real revenue attribution; no bot-log analytics, execution is customer-operated
BrandlightEnterprise CMO orgs buying through salesUndisclosed; custom enterpriseStrong logos and an ads/commerce roadmap; depth not publicly verifiable
Goodie AITeams wanting a small full-stack vendorQuote-onlyClosest full-stack analog at tiny-vendor scale; one of the few with attribution
Ahrefs Brand RadarAhrefs shops adding AI-mention dataReported ~$828+/mo all-in real costMonthly chatbot refresh, data-only; no Claude coverage listed as of June 2026
Surfer AI TrackerSMB content teams already on SurferPricing in transition as of June 2026Five engines, content-team angle; no crawler analytics
OtterlySolo marketers and SMBs testing the waterSMB price anchor for the categoryEntry-level tracking; far from a program
DaydreamBrands wanting a full-service AI-native agencyReported $15K–50K/mo retainersThe other “done-for-you”, agency retainer economics vs our scoped engagements
Rankscale / Knowatoa / Hall / GaugeBudget and indie testingLow-cost tiers varyLightweight trackers; Hall notably does offer crawler analytics
HubSpot AEOHubSpot customers wanting a checkbox$50/mo, 3 enginesAn add-on, not a discipline
Adobe LLM Optimizer / Yext Scout / SimilarwebIncumbent-stack enterprisesEnterprise; varies by suiteAI visibility as a feature of a bigger platform, consolidation plays to watch
